Output 3ec74311823398b4a57ab521153ae8851ee10e261129761f122fe7ad5c96299b:1

value
76660000
script pubkey
OP_0 OP_PUSHBYTES_20 8e8c481f5a7ed73b2d423f80c41aef52613bceb2
address
ltc1q36xys8660mtnkt2z87qvgxh02fsnhn4jn7jghe
transaction
3ec74311823398b4a57ab521153ae8851ee10e261129761f122fe7ad5c96299b
spent
true